Grinding Mill Vibration Cause It has already been pointed out that, owing to the periodicity of any surging motion of the charge within the shell and to the collapse of the toe of the charge, the fluctuations of the torque transmitted by the driving mechanism will contain a very large number of harmonics.

A vibration mill is a type of grinding mill that uses vibration to mill, grind, or polish materials. Unlike other milling techniques that rely on impact, compression, or shear forces, a vibration mill applies mechanical vibration energy to the material, which causes high-frequency collisions and friction between the particles.

Vibration mill is a kind of mechanical crushing equipment, which uses grinding media (ball or rod) to exert strong impact, friction, shearing, squeezing and other effects on the material in the cylinder for high-frequency vibration, so that the processed material can reach fracture, Crushing, thinning, mixing and other purposes.
